Does Goats Eat Apples. Apples should be sliced up into smaller pieces for easy chewing, and goats shouldn’t be fed more than one apple per day. A great way to make eating an apple even more fun for your goats is to slice the apple into pieces and spread the pieces around their pen so that it takes a while to find them all. But don’t give too many at once. But, like the majority of other fruits they should be eaten in moderation. Apples are safe for goats to eat in limited quantities.
